Common Signs of a Failing Aux Cord
Before diving into troubleshooting, recognize the symptoms of a faulty aux connection:
- No sound output from connected device
- Intermittent audio or static noise
- Sound only in one ear (mono output)
- Device recognizes connection but doesn’t switch audio output
- Volume fluctuates when adjusting cord position
These signs often point to specific problems, whether mechanical, electrical, or software-related. Identifying which symptom you're experiencing helps narrow down the cause.
Step-by-Step Guide: Diagnosing the Problem
Follow this logical sequence to isolate where the failure occurs:
- Test the aux cord on another device. Plug it into a different smartphone, laptop, or speaker. If it works elsewhere, the issue likely lies with your original device’s port.
- Try a different aux cord on the same device. A known-working cable will confirm whether the problem is the cord itself.
- Inspect both ends of the cable. Look for bent pins, frayed wires, or corrosion. Even minor bends in the plug can break internal connections.
- Clean the aux port. Use compressed air or a soft brush to remove lint and debris from the jack on your device. Avoid metal tools that could cause shorts.
- Check audio settings. Ensure the device hasn’t defaulted to Bluetooth or another output source. On smartphones, disable any “do not disturb” or media routing restrictions.
- Restart the device. Sometimes, a simple reboot resolves temporary software hiccups affecting audio routing.
Physical Damage: The Most Common Culprit
The majority of aux cord failures stem from wear and tear. Cords are frequently bent, twisted, or pulled from ports, leading to broken internal wiring. The weakest points are typically near the connectors, where stress concentrates.
Common types of physical damage include:
- Frayed insulation exposing copper wires
- Bent or flattened 3.5mm plug tips
- Loose connection when inserted (wobbles in the jack)
- Internal wire breaks invisible to the naked eye
A telltale sign of internal breakage is when wiggling the cord produces intermittent sound. This indicates a severed conductor inside the cable. While some users attempt soldering repairs, these are often short-lived due to repeated strain.

Do’s and Don’ts: Handling Your Aux Cord Properly
| Do’s | Don’ts |
|---|---|
| Unplug by gripping the plug, not the cord | Pull the cable sharply from the port |
| Store loosely coiled in a protective case | Wrap tightly around devices or fold sharply |
| Use dust caps if available | Leave cables exposed to moisture or extreme heat |
| Replace frayed cords immediately | Continue using a cable with inconsistent audio |
Proper handling significantly extends cable lifespan. Rolling instead of twisting prevents internal wire fatigue. Avoid stepping on or placing heavy objects on cords, especially when in use.
Device-Specific Issues and Software Conflicts
Sometimes, the aux cord works perfectly—but the device fails to respond. Modern smartphones and computers may misinterpret input signals or default to wireless outputs.
Common software-related issues include:
- Bluetooth priority overriding wired connections
- Outdated firmware preventing proper detection
- Audio routing bugs after OS updates
- Third-party apps blocking system-level audio switching
On iPhones, ensure that \"Audio Routing\" in Control Center isn’t set to AirPods or another accessory. Android users should check Developer Options for USB audio settings that might interfere. Restarting the device usually resets these glitches.

Testing Tools and Methods for Accurate Diagnosis
If basic checks don’t resolve the issue, use advanced methods to verify functionality:
- Multimeter testing: Set to continuity mode and touch probes to corresponding tip, ring, and sleeve contacts on both ends. A beep confirms intact wiring.
- Aux splitter adapter: Plug in headphones while the cord is connected to a playing device. If you hear sound, the cable is functional but the output device has an issue.
- Audio loopback app: Some Android apps generate tone through the headphone jack, helping confirm output capability independent of external devices.

FAQ
Can a damaged aux cord be repaired?
Minor frays can be temporarily fixed with heat-shrink tubing or electrical tape, but internal wire breaks usually require soldering. Given the low cost of replacement cables, repair is rarely cost-effective unless done professionally or for high-end audiophile cords.
Why does my aux cord work in headphones but not in my car?
This often indicates a mismatch in impedance or cable shielding. Car stereos may have deeper jacks or stricter signal requirements. Also, check if the car's input is TRS (stereo) vs. TRRS (mic-enabled). A TRRS cable may not make full contact in a TRS-only jack.
Do expensive aux cables make a difference?
For most users, no. Well-made budget cables perform identically to premium ones over short distances. However, higher-end cables offer better shielding, strain relief, and durability—worth considering for professional or high-fidelity use.
